I don’t know if ya’ll have heard anything about Dubai’s Islands but here’s the skinny.  The country of Dubai used to be a major oil exporter but reports indicate that their oil will run out in 2016 so to combat that loss of income they have started a huge initiative to become a tourist attraction.  They have done this by building the world’s tallest hotel, they are in the process of building two skyscrapers that will be the world’s tallest buildings and they have built (and are in the process of building) islands.  Yes you heard (read) right, islands.  They have two completed in the shape of palm trees and are in the process of building an archipelago of islands in the shape of the world and another larger palm tree.
